Who Were The Denisovan Humans?

In 2010 it was discovered that a mysterious human relative had once lived in a cave in Siberia. After a decade of research on these Denisovans a lot has been revealed about them – from their distribution, to their interbreeding with modern humans, and possibly even what they looked like.
